Volkswagen e-Golf
A compact electric hatchback best suited to city driving, the Volkswagen e-Golf balances five-seat practicality with a modest 200 km range. It offers good value in its segment if your routine includes short commutes and easy charging.

Honda Accord Crosstour
A five-seat, FWD gasoline family car that emphasizes space, reliability, and safety, with a generous 660 L trunk. Performance is competent rather than sporty, and at $30,000 it offers good value for growing families and road trips.

Pros & cons

Volkswagen e-Golf

  • City-friendly 200 km range that covers typical daily commutes.
  • Five seats and a usable 341 L trunk suit family-compact duties.
  • Smooth, quiet EV drive with 136 hp and 290 Nm for responsive urban trips.
  • Priced at 31,495, representing good value in its segment.

Honda Accord Crosstour

  • Large 660 L cargo area suits family gear and road trips.
  • Signals a focus on reliability and safety.
  • Good value in its segment at $30,000.
  • Adequate daily performance (190 hp, 0–100 km/h in 7.5 s).
